- module namespace json = "http://marklogic.com/json";
 
- declare default function namespace "http://www.w3.org/2005/xpath-functions";
 
- (: Need to backslash escape any double quotes, backslashes, and newlines :)
 
- declare function json:escape($s as xs:string) as xs:string {
 
-   let $s := replace($s, "\\", "\\\\")
 
-   let $s := replace($s, """", "\\""")
 
-   let $s := replace($s, codepoints-to-string((13, 10)), "\\n")
 
-   let $s := replace($s, codepoints-to-string(13), "\\n")
 
-   let $s := replace($s, codepoints-to-string(10), "\\n")
 
-   return $s
 
- };
 
- declare function json:atomize($x as element()) as xs:string {
 
-   if (count($x/node()) = 0) then 'null'
 
-   else if ($x/@type = "number") then
 
-     let $castable := $x castable as xs:float or
 
-                      $x castable as xs:double or
 
-                      $x castable as xs:decimal
 
-     return
 
-     if ($castable) then xs:string($x)
 
-     else error(concat("Not a number: ", xdmp:describe($x)))
 
-   else if ($x/@type = "boolean") then
 
-     let $castable := $x castable as xs:boolean
 
-     return
 
-     if ($castable) then xs:string(xs:boolean($x))
 
-     else error(concat("Not a boolean: ", xdmp:describe($x)))
 
-   else concat('"', json:escape($x), '"')
 
- };
 
- (: Print the thing that comes after the colon :)
 
- declare function json:print-value($x as element()) as xs:string {
 
-   if (count($x/*) = 0) then
 
-     json:atomize($x)
 
-   else if ($x/@quote = "true") then
 
-     concat('"', json:escape(xdmp:quote($x/node())), '"')
 
-   else
 
-     string-join(('{',
 
-       string-join(for $i in $x/* return json:print-name-value($i), ","),
 
-     '}'), "")
 
- };
 
- (: Print the name and value both :)
 
- declare function json:print-name-value($x as element()) as xs:string? {
 
-   let $name := name($x)
 
-   let $first-in-array :=
 
-     count($x/preceding-sibling::*[name(.) = $name]) = 0 and
 
-     (count($x/following-sibling::*[name(.) = $name]) > 0 or $x/@array = "true")
 
-   let $later-in-array := count($x/preceding-sibling::*[name(.) = $name]) > 0
 
-   return
 
-   if ($later-in-array) then
 
-     ()  (: I was handled previously :)
 
-   else if ($first-in-array) then
 
-     string-join(('"', json:escape($name), '":[',
 
-       string-join((for $i in ($x, $x/following-sibling::*[name(.) = $name]) return json:print-value($i)), ","),
 
-     ']'), "")
 
-    else
 
-      string-join(('"', json:escape($name), '":', json:print-value($x)), "")
 
- };
 
- (:~
 
-   Transforms an XML element into a JSON string representation.  See http://json.org.
 
-   <p/>
 
-   Sample usage:
 
-   <pre>
 
-     xquery version "1.0-ml";
 
-     import module namespace json="http://marklogic.com/json" at "json.xqy";
 
-     json:serialize(&lt;foo&gt;&lt;bar&gt;kid&lt;/bar&gt;&lt;/foo&gt;)
 
-   </pre>
 
-   Sample transformations:
 
-   <pre>
 
-   &lt;e/&gt; becomes {"e":null}
 
-   &lt;e&gt;text&lt;/e&gt; becomes {"e":"text"}
 
-   &lt;e&gt;quote " escaping&lt;/e&gt; becomes {"e":"quote \" escaping"}
 
-   &lt;e&gt;backslash \ escaping&lt;/e&gt; becomes {"e":"backslash \\ escaping"}
 
-   &lt;e&gt;&lt;a&gt;text1&lt;/a&gt;&lt;b&gt;text2&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/e&gt; becomes {"e":{"a":"text1","b":"text2"}}
 
-   &lt;e&gt;&lt;a&gt;text1&lt;/a&gt;&lt;a&gt;text2&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/e&gt; becomes {"e":{"a":["text1","text2"]}}
 
-   &lt;e&gt;&lt;a array="true"&gt;text1&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/e&gt; becomes {"e":{"a":["text1"]}}
 
-   &lt;e&gt;&lt;a type="boolean"&gt;false&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/e&gt; becomes {"e":{"a":false}}
 
-   &lt;e&gt;&lt;a type="number"&gt;123.5&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/e&gt; becomes {"e":{"a":123.5}}
 
-   &lt;e quote="true"&gt;&lt;div attrib="value"/&gt;&lt;/e&gt; becomes {"e":"&lt;div attrib=\"value\"/&gt;"}
 
-   </pre>
 
-   <p/>
 
-   Namespace URIs are ignored.  Namespace prefixes are included in the JSON name.
 
-   <p/>
 
-   Attributes are ignored, except for the special attribute @array="true" that
 
-   indicates the JSON serialization should write the node, even if single, as an
 
-   array, and the attribute @type that can be set to "boolean" or "number" to
 
-   dictate the value should be written as that type (unquoted).  There's also
 
-   an @quote attribute that when set to true writes the inner content as text
 
-   rather than as structured JSON, useful for sending some XHTML over the
 
-   wire.
 
-   <p/>
 
-   Text nodes within mixed content are ignored.
 
-   @param $x Element node to convert
 
-   @return String holding JSON serialized representation of $x
 
-   @author Jason Hunter
 
-   @version 1.0.1
 
-   
 
-   Ported to xquery 1.0-ml; double escaped backslashes in json:escape
 
- :)
 
- declare function json:serialize($x as element())  as xs:string {
 
-   string-join(('{', json:print-name-value($x), '}'), "")
 
- };
